首页 > 生活百科 >

如何设置excel中长数字下拉时递增?

2025-06-14 07:17:58

问题描述:

如何设置excel中长数字下拉时递增?,快急哭了,求给个思路吧!

最佳答案

推荐答案

2025-06-14 07:17:58

在日常办公和数据分析中,Excel是一款非常强大的工具,尤其是在处理大量数据时。然而,当需要输入一串长数字并希望它们能够自动递增时,很多人可能会感到困惑。例如,在生成订单编号、产品编号或身份证号等场景中,这种需求尤为常见。本文将详细介绍如何在Excel中实现这一功能。

方法一:使用填充柄与格式设置

1. 输入起始数字

在单元格A1中输入你想要的起始长数字。例如,“123456789012345”。

2. 调整单元格格式

选中该单元格,右键选择“设置单元格格式”。在弹出的窗口中,切换到“数字”选项卡,然后选择“文本”。这样可以确保Excel将输入的内容视为文本而非数值,避免出现科学计数法的问题。

3. 拖动填充柄

将鼠标移动到单元格右下角的小黑点(即填充柄),按住左键向下拖动。当你松开鼠标后,Excel会自动递增填充后续的单元格。

方法二:利用公式实现递增

如果你需要更灵活的操作,比如根据特定规则生成递增值,可以借助Excel的公式功能:

1. 输入起始值并定义步长

在A1单元格输入起始值,如“123456789012345”,并在B1单元格输入步长值,如“1”。

2. 编写公式

在C1单元格输入以下公式:

```excel

=TEXT(A1+(ROW()-1)B1,"0")

```

这里的`TEXT`函数用于将数字转换为文本格式,确保不会丢失前导零。

3. 向下填充

将C1单元格的公式向下拖动,即可得到递增的长数字序列。

注意事项

- 避免科学计数法:如果输入的数字位数超过15位,Excel会默认将其转换为科学计数法表示。因此,在输入之前务必先设置单元格格式为“文本”。

- 检查数据一致性:生成的数据可能包含多余的空格或其他字符,请仔细核对以保证准确性。

通过以上两种方法,你可以轻松地在Excel中实现长数字序列的自动递增。无论是简单的填充还是复杂的逻辑运算,Excel都能满足你的需求。希望这些技巧能帮助你在工作中更加得心应手!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。